Act
Applause for the first Act, an innovative projector for accurate light modelling. Its outstanding and flexible optical system, developed with Bartenbach GmbH, allows playing with integrated lens and nanostructure foils to design light with extreme plasticity, adaptive to diverse objects, spaces or scene requirements.
Design: Serge Cornelissen
Design your light with Act in two steps
Step 1.
Rotate the larger knurled ring to zoom in and out. Each 180º rotation represents a beam angle difference of 8,4º, with a range of 10 rotations, from 14º to 100º.
Step 2.
Rotate the narrower knurled ring to shape your form, limited to the zoom ring's position. Design a soft or defined circular from or transform it from circular to elliptical shape.
Breaking a standard
The beam angle is the angle which contains 50% of the luminous intensity of the light beam. The field angle ends when the luminous intensity reaches 10% of its maximum. The proximity of the beam and field angles determines the light beam definition.
Act shapes defined, homogenous and uniformed light beams in each variation and softness steps. Higher beam definition with similar beam and field angles, and higher beam softness with smooth transition between beam and field angles.
